Bardo Pond - Batholith (LP) - three lobed $20.00
"released early march 2008. batholith is a collection of six tracks
that are near and dear to bardo pond but, for some reason or another,
have never previously been released. that one-sentence description
might lead one to think that these tracks are "outtakes" or cutting-
room floor type material - neither conclusion could be further from
the truth. the tracks included on batholith range from previous live
staples ("a tune," one made 'famous' by opening bardo's set at
terrastock II in san francisco as joined by roy montgomery [and a
recording of which was featured on the KFJC compilation live from the
devil's triangle, volume 2]) to tracks the band recorded in john peel
sessions ("slip away", also available here as a downloadable .mp3
preview). collected as a whole, these tracks form a fluid and
cohesive album. batholith is not just an exciting moment for long
time bardo pond fans, but a great jumping on point for folks who are
relatively new to their craft. as per the three
lobed standard, batholith is pressed on 180g RTI vinyl. it is housed
within heavy "old-style" one-pocket stoughton gatefold jackets
bearing new artwork by john gibbons and isobel sollenberger. the
record is from an edition of 1049 copies and, and as an added
convenience for our vinyl friends, will come packaged with a glass-
mastered CD (not CD-R) of the material present on the wax. pre-
ordered copies were accompanied by a bonus CD (TLR-044) of previously
unreleased bardo pond material."

Knife World - s/t (LP) - roaratorio $16.00
"Formed in Minneapolis in 2004, Knife World have converted many
unwary bystanders into true believers through their frenetic gigs in
underground venues and the occasional club. The band worships at the
Riff Temple, swapping pomposity for a mischievous intelligence. Jon
Nielsen sounds as if he's scrambling to play all the guitar parts of
some skewed arena-rock mashup at once, while drummer Josh Journey-
Heinz avoids the obvious backbeats by carving out the spaces around
them instead. Together they have a fuller sound than most groups with
more appendages. A self-released cassette and a cd-r served up hints
and guesses, but now their debut LP comes along to deliver the goods.
Packaged in a pleasantly eye-gouging 3D gatefold jacket, with glasses
mounted into the vinyl."

Paul Metzger - Gedanken Splitter (LP) - roaratorio $15.00
"Paul Metzger continues to pile up the plaudits from critics and
peers alike for his virtuosic string-slinging, gaining notice through
his CD on Chairkickers and his split LP with Ben Chasny and Chris
Corsano on Roaratorio. Metzger’s modified banjo is tricked out with
additional sympathetic raga strings, although the compositions on
Gedanken Splitter are informed by much more than Eastern drone music
alone. Recorded in the same period as 2007’s Deliverance on Locust
Music, this is a more jagged and aggressive (although no less
accessible) affair. Metzger winds these improvisations around
thornier threads than on his previous releases, and while never
turning completely abstract, Gedanken Splitter moves even further
away from anything resembling typical banjo fare. This is mesmerizing
and singular playing." ---- "Gedanken Splitter is ferocious, frantic,
yet entirely on-course -- easily Metzger's most aggressive waxing
yet." - Bill Meyer, Signal To Noise
